The Arthritis Score in 49635, Frankfort, Michigan is 52 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

85.93 percent of the population in 49635 drive to work alone. 1.57 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 77.31 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 6.76 percent of the residents in 49635 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.08 members with about 2.12 cars available per household.

An estimate of 90.67 percent of the residents in 49635 has some form of health insurance. 52.84 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 65.47 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 49635 would have to travel an average of 0.93 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Paul Oliver Memorial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 49635, Frankfort, Michigan.

As of , an estimate of 3,238 residents live in 49635 with a median age of 59.6 years. 12.04 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 38.45 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 33.63 percent of the residents in 49635 is currently married, and 21.00 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 49635 is $7,282.17.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 49635 is approximately $843. The median household spends about 11.58 percent of their income on housing.

Frankfort has a storied past dating back to the late 19th century when it was established as a port town on Lake Michigan. The town's history is evident in its well-preserved architecture and historic downtown area.
